What does the delivery health certificate need to check?

Send takeout and get a health certificate. This situation requires going to the local CDC. Generally, it is necessary to check the liver and kidney function and blood routine of four kinds of infections, including hepatitis B, syphilis, AIDS and hepatitis C. According to the Food Safety Law, the Regulations on Hygiene Management in Public Places and other laws and regulations, relevant personnel engaged in food production and management, public service, professional production of cosmetics, disposable medical and health care products, toxic, harmful and radioactive operations, and child care institutions must have health certificates. Health certificate refers to the proof of preventive health examination, which proves that the examinee has the health quality to engage in the prescribed business. Legal basis:

Regulations on health management in public places

Seventh people who directly serve customers in public places must hold a "health certificate" before they can engage in their own work. Persons suffering from dysentery, typhoid fever, viral hepatitis, active tuberculosis, purulent or exudative skin diseases and other diseases that hinder public health shall not engage in direct customer service before they are cured.

Article 45 of People's Republic of China (PRC) Food Safety Law

Food producers and business operators shall establish and implement the health management system for employees. Persons suffering from diseases that hinder food safety as stipulated by the administrative department of health of the State Council shall not engage in direct contact with imported food.

Food production and marketing personnel engaged in direct contact with imported food shall undergo annual health examination and obtain health certificates before taking up their posts.
